To solve this, a solo developer built Pistachio—an integrated back-office operations platform tailored for teams under 200 people. Rather than bolting on regulatory mandates as an afterthought, the platform treats GDPR and audit-grade compliance as a foundational architecture decision. Six core modules—covering time tracking, leave, CRM, and expense management—are built on a shared base of identity, permissions, and audit trails. This interconnected framework eliminates reliance on external libraries, replacing fragmented spreadsheets and isolated apps with a unified system that is audit-ready from day one. Crucially, scaling such a system as a solo engineer requires strict adherence to a rigid design system. While AI "vibe coding" tools offer early speed, they quickly turn scaling codebases into unmanageable slop; enforcing strict UI and structural constraints is what actually enables sustainable, rapid update cycles.
